ASUS P5LD2



Processor ASUS P5LD2

Socket:
LGA775
Processors supported:
Intel Celeron D/Pentium 4/Pentium D
System bus:
533 MHz 1066 MHz
Support Hyper-Threading Technology:
yes
Support for multi-core processors:
yes

Chipset ASUS P5LD2

Chipset:
Intel 945P / g chipset
BIOS:
AMI c possibility of a disaster recovery
SLI/CrossFire:?Scalable Link Interface
no

Memory ASUS P5LD2

Memory:
DDR2 DIMMs 400 to 667 MHz
Number of memory slots:
4
Supports dual channel mode:
yes
Maximum memory:
4 GB

Disk controllers ASUS P5LD2

IDE:?Integrated Drive Electronics
number of slots: 3, UltraDMA 133
SATA:?Serial Advanced Technology Attachment
number of connectors SATA 1.5Gb/s: 4, RAID: 0, 1, 5, 10 based on the Intel ICH7R

Expansion slots ASUS P5LD2

Expansion slots:
1xPCI-E x16, 3xPCI-E x1, 3xPCI

Audio/video ASUS P5LD2

Sound:
7.1CH, HDA, based on the Realtek ALC882

Network ASUS P5LD2

Ethernet:
1000 Mbps, based on the Marvell 88E8053

Connection ASUS P5LD2

Interfaces:
8 USB, S/PDIF output, 1xCOM, GAME/MIDI, Ethernet, PS/2 (keyboard), PS/2 (mouse), LPT
Back panel connectors:
4 USB, coaxial output, optical output, 1xCOM, Ethernet, PS/2 (keyboard), PS/2 (mouse), LPT
Main power connector:
24-pin
Processor power connector:
4-pin

Advanced settings ASUS P5LD2

Form factor:
ATX
Packing list:
2 Serial ATA cable, 1 cable 2-port SATA power, 2 module 2-port USB2.0, 1 cable UltraDMA 133/100/66, 1 cable IDE 1 FDD cable
Additional information:
ASUS AI NOS - system instant acceleration. Fanless execution. The ASUS AI Quiet dynamically controls the speed of the processor. ASUS AI Net2 - notification of faults network cable. WiFi-TV (optional)
